Skip to main content

An alternative datetime library for Python.

Project description

PyPI - Status PyPI - Version PyPI - Python Version GitHub License Documentation Status codecov

Pyoda Time

Pyoda Time is an alternative date and time API for Python.

It helps you to think about your data more clearly, and express operations on that data more precisely.

This project is a Python port of Noda Time, an alternative DateTime library for .NET (which in turn was inspired by Joda Time).

Installation

pip install pyoda-time

Quick Start

Coming soon!

In the meantime, view the docs.

Project Status

Pyoda Time is currently in the pre-alpha stage, with fundamental logic and features being actively developed.

The project goal is to provide a powerful alternative for time management in Python, drawing inspiration from the strengths of Noda Time and adapting them to a Pythonic API.

Contributions

Contributions of all kinds are welcome.

If you are interested in contributing to this project, please refer to the guidelines.

Acknowledgements

We express our gratitude to the authors and contributors of Noda Time and Joda Time for their pioneering work in the field of date and time management. Pyoda Time aspires to continue this tradition within the Python ecosystem.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pyoda_time-0.9.3.tar.gz (4.2 MB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

pyoda_time-0.9.3-py3-none-any.whl (423.0 kB view details)

Uploaded Python 3

File details

Details for the file pyoda_time-0.9.3.tar.gz.

File metadata

  • Download URL: pyoda_time-0.9.3.tar.gz
  • Upload date:
  • Size: 4.2 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.5.10

File hashes

Hashes for pyoda_time-0.9.3.tar.gz
Algorithm Hash digest
SHA256 6045b10fe3cfa6784d0db3fcef233744b19e825b6db7e863026d741af5beb586
MD5 1191e52e0e5ed02df98b7b84af06f18c
BLAKE2b-256 df65855ae0e4f903e4b9b35eedb8362137515c3fc14b7a914821244606c0bf95

See more details on using hashes here.

File details

Details for the file pyoda_time-0.9.3-py3-none-any.whl.

File metadata

  • Download URL: pyoda_time-0.9.3-py3-none-any.whl
  • Upload date:
  • Size: 423.0 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: uv/0.5.10

File hashes

Hashes for pyoda_time-0.9.3-py3-none-any.whl
Algorithm Hash digest
SHA256 81a753929d78708fd456722fe845a5c2d60d42df099756ec0c8ba76cc5e16fd7
MD5 5570d59236c3eef70169c772f8be84e0
BLAKE2b-256 28a54e414749ffbaa9cb672b36e03b86f094209a356b6d0091e73274b3149152

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page